The legal industry is evolving at an unprecedented pace—and the expectations placed on legal leaders are shifting just as quickly. Today’s professionals aren’t only advisors; they are strategic leaders, innovators, and decision-makers navigating a world of disruption. From new global regulations and AI governance, to shifting business models and workplace dynamics, leadership is being tested like never before.

This complimentary webcast, a preview of content from Law.com International’s December Leadership in Law conference in London, will provide legal professionals with the practical insights needed to adapt and succeed in this era of change.

Topics covered will include:

  • What makes a successful leader in today’s legal landscape and strategies to remain competitive and future-proof your career
  • How global changes are reshaping leadership roles and career paths
  • The difference between leadership approaches across in-house and private practice settings
  • Aligning with shifting expectations from clients, corporations, and legal teams
  • Adapting to the AI era and preparing for the EU AI Act, UK AI governance, and beyond
